Screenings will look at basic age appropriate skills for a child's understanding and expression of language. Simple sound inventory will be assessed during screening. Once screening is completed, a therapist will determine if a more in depth comprehensive evaluation is needed.
During the evaluation you can expect to discuss your concerns with speech and language. A therapist will conduct an evaluation through parent questionnaire, observation, and formal standardized testing. Based on the evaluation results, the therapist will determine if therapy is warranted.
We offer family training and education during every session for carryover and generalization of therapy techniques. Treatment services include: receptive & expressive language delays, articulation/
phonological delays, pragmatic delays, alternative & augmented communication, fluency disorders, and feeding & swallowing disorders.
Our therapists are highly knowledgeable in the teletherapy service delivery model and can provide successful intervention services for children ages 1+ years. Staff are trained to keep young children engaged with varying levels of communication needs. Therapy typically consists of clinician led tasks with a mixture of parent coaching for our younger patients.
